Typical, quality TD05 20Gs will make 380-400 bhp on road fuel, V-Power or Momentum.
It is a myth that an FMIC adds any significant lag.
93-96 cars will benefit from an efficient front mount beyond 300 bhp. 97-00 cars show benefits from a front mount by 320 bhp and New Age cars can already benefit from an efficient front mount by 350-360 bhp, particularly the WRX.
A new TD05 20G is £850.
